    We enjoyed our recent experience at FLINT. We made a reservation on the earlier side on a Saturday night and it was surprisingly quite. The interior is beautiful and comfortable; and valet is free so it was easy to park. Our server was great; very attentive and did a through job of explaining how the menu works. Food came out quick and it everything was great. I wouldn't say anything knocked us off our feet, but it was all consistently good. We split the roasted cauliflower, the short rib hummus (our favorite), the burrata, the lamb meatballs, one chicken kabab, and the fried chicken. They coursed everything out perfectly. Drinks were also tasty; dessert was a miss. We ordered the olive oil pound cake and it was very dry. BUT, our sweet server noticed I was pregnant and brought us a free donut dessert as a congratulations. It was incredibly kind of him and it made up for the pound cake. Overall, it was a great date night spot. If we're ever in the area, we'd try it again!

    Flint is contemporary American fare accented with bold Middle Eastern cuisine (always my favorite) It's set inside a stunning, two-story indoor-outdoor space overlooking Camelback Road and stunning mountains as. The gleaming exhibition kitchen is tucked behind a glass wall and boasts gorgeous, mid-century modern decor mixed with Ernest Hemingway style furniture. This restaurant offers so many choices for plant-based (vegan) dining. Let me tell you about some of my favorite (still wish they had the -Grilled artichokes, that was amazing. But there are still some good choices for plant based foodies like me - -The creamiest hummus you could ever taste mantled with touch of harissa and Za'atar the best with house -made pita makes a good scoop fresh and hot (fav of my husband) I like to use fresh veggies with it. That's why l order crudités. -Chapped salad usually with meat but they will make it for you without. This Arabic salad with Za'atar DRESSING is my favorite salad in Phoenix. Menu changes seasonly

    Do you have GF options safe for celiacs?

    Hello Cindy! We have gluten-friendly options; however, our equipment is shared with non-gluten-free items, and we do not have a dedicated space that is 100% gluten-free. We apologize for any inconvenience!

    Are there vegan options/vegan menu?

    Hi Ashley, The kitchen would be able to accommodate vegan requests. We do not have a specific vegan… 

    Do you charge a cake cutting fee for bringing in our own dessert?

    Hello! FLINT has a $5 cake cutting fee for each slice we serve/plate for the guests. Thank you for your inquiry!

    Are kids allowed on the balcony to see the view also?

    No. Do not bring kids here.

    Are they still serving the Smoke Bone Marrow small plate?

    Yes, as of May 2022 we do still serve the bone marrow dish.

    Is there a bar area that doesn't require reservations? This place was recommended and open table shows no reservations.

    Yes, the bar and lounge tables downstairs as well and the upstairs bar are all first come first serve and do not accept reservations. Always be sure to check with our social media for any closures for private events.
